Resilience, Mentorship, and a People-First Mindset: A Conversation with Jon Rodammer with Kenvue
In this insightful conversation from the Gartner Supply Chain Symposium, Scott Luton of Supply Chain Now sits down with Jon Rodammer, Senior VP and Head of North America Operations at Kenvue. Jon shares his inspiring leadership journey and the values that guide him—resilience, mentorship, and a people-first mindset.
They explore:
- The power of agility and responsiveness in today’s supply chains
- Why digitization and system investments matter for newly independent companies
- How Jon’s experience with top consumer goods brands shaped his “consumer-first” approach
- The role of mentorship and community service in building strong leadership
- Kenvue’s cultural commitment to continuous improvement and operational excellence
Whether you’re navigating supply chain disruption or growing a team, Jon’s insights are packed with real-world value.
